The Importance of Savanna Mammals in Seed Dispersal

In the savanna ecosystem, mammals play an essential role in the process of seed dispersal, contributing significantly to the health and sustainability of this biome. Many savanna mammals, including elephants, giraffes, and various rodents, consume fruits and seeds as part of their normal diets, which is vital for the growth of new plants. By ingesting seeds and later excreting them in different locations, these mammals facilitate the spread of plant species across vast distances. The dispersal patterns also allow plants to colonize new areas, improving biodiversity within the savanna. Different species have unique mechanisms for dispersal; for instance, elephants can move substantial quantities of seeds due to their size. This further leads to increased plant variety, which also enhances the habitat of the savanna itself. Moreover, some seeds benefit from the digestive process, sprouting more effectively post-consumption. These interactions between savanna mammals and plants are a fundamental aspect of ecological balance, ensuring that forest and grassland ecosystems thrive. Therefore, protecting these mammals is critical, as their absence could lead to significant declines in plant diversity and overall savanna health.

Challenges Facing Savanna Mammals

Despite their essential role in seed dispersal, savanna mammals face numerous challenges that threaten their populations and, consequently, the ecosystems they help sustain. Habitat destruction due to agriculture and urbanization poses a significant threat to these mammals’ survival. As their habitats shrink, mammals are forced into smaller areas, which hinders their ability to find food and reproduce effectively. Furthermore, poaching for ivory, bushmeat, and other wildlife products has led to significant declines in elephant and rhinoceros populations. Such declines disrupt the intricate ecological grip that these animals have on seed dispersal dynamics. Climate change is another major factor, impacting rainfall patterns and the overall temperature of savanna regions. This disruption can alter the seasonal growth patterns of plants that depend on mammals for reproduction. Moreover, invasive species can compete with native plants and disrupt traditional relationships between mammals and flora. The cumulative effects of these threats lead to reduced genetic diversity among both plant and animal species, jeopardizing the resilience of the entire savanna ecosystem. Conservation programs must now address these challenges to safeguard both mammals and the health of their ecological networks.
